Maggie Haberman's book may hold the answer The latest Trump tell-all book is New York Times reporter Maggie Haberman's "[Confidence Man: The Making of Donald Trump and the Breaking of America](~/AASU4wA~/RgRlFVzWP0QpaHR0cHM6Ly9ib29rc2hvcC5vcmcvYS8yNDY0Lzk3ODA1OTMyOTczNDZXA3NwY0IKYyLZ1zJjFrwCS1IbdHJpc3RyYW1iYWxkd2luODVAZ21haWwuY29tWAQAAAAo)," to be published next week. An article adapted from the book appeared in the [Atlantic](~/AASU4wA~/RgRlFVzWP0RhaHR0cHM6Ly93d3cudGhlYXRsYW50aWMuY29tL2lkZWFzL2FyY2hpdmUvMjAyMi8wOS9kb25hbGQtdHJ1bXAtbWFnZ2llLWhhYmVybWFuLW1hci1hLWxhZ28vNjcxNTEwL1cDc3BjQgpjItnXMmMWvAJLUht0cmlzdHJhbWJhbGR3aW44NUBnbWFpbC5jb21YBAAAACg~) over the weekend, dropping least one major hint at the answer to one of the great questions hovering over the former president since the FBI executed that search warrant at Mar-a-Lago early in August: Why did Donald Trump take all those classified documents from the White House? Speculation so far basically boils down to three main possibilities. The first is that Trump is a hoarder who can't throw anything away. But come on. There's more to this than that. The second speculation is that he took the items with the intention of selling them, to someone, somewhere down the line. Considering that Trump considers himself the greatest dealmaker the world has ever known, this is also a plausible explanation. While it's hard to imagine that he would sell classified intelligence to an adversary outright, it's not out of the question that he might have thought they'd be worth hanging on to as a sweetener in some future transaction. The last speculation is the one that seems most likely, considering his known penchant for blackmail. [Arizona-state-capitol-building-in-Phoenix] Getty Images / DustyPixel Back to petticoats: Arizona's 1864 abortion ban shows GOP longs to force women into the past For some time, Arizona has been near the front of the pack of Republican-controlled states itching to ban abortion. Gov. Doug Ducey didn't wait for the June [overturn of Roe v. Wade](~/AASU4wA~/RgRlFVzWP0RYaHR0cHM6Ly93d3cuc2Fsb24uY29tLzIwMjIvMDYvMjQvdGhlLWVuZC1vZi1yb2Utdi13YWRlLWFtZXJpY2FuLWRlbW9jcmFjeS1pcy1jb2xsYXBzaW5nL1cDc3BjQgpjItnXMmMWvAJLUht0cmlzdHJhbWJhbGR3aW44NUBnbWFpbC5jb21YBAAAACg~) or even for the leak of the [Dobbs v. Jackson Women's Health](~/AASU4wA~/RgRlFVzWP0RoaHR0cHM6Ly93d3cuc2Fsb24uY29tLzIwMjIvMDUvMDMvc2FtdWVsLWFsaXRvcy1sZWFrZWQtYW50aS1hYm9ydGlvbi1kZWNpc2lvbi1kb2VzbnQtcGxhbi10by1zdG9wLWF0LXJvZS9XA3NwY0IKYyLZ1zJjFrwCS1IbdHJpc3RyYW1iYWxkd2luODVAZ21haWwuY29tWAQAAAAo) ruling in May. Merely anticipating such a decision was enough for the Republican governor to [sign a 15-week abortion ban in March](~/AASU4wA~/RgRlFVzWP0RhaHR0cHM6Ly93d3cucmV1dGVycy5jb20vd29ybGQvdXMvYXJpem9uYS1nb3Zlcm5vci1zaWducy0xNS13ZWVrLWFib3J0aW9uLWJhbi1pbnRvLWxhdy0yMDIyLTAzLTMwL1cDc3BjQgpjItnXMmMWvAJLUht0cmlzdHJhbWJhbGR3aW44NUBnbWFpbC5jb21YBAAAACg~). But even that didn't go far enough for the state's Republican attorney general, Mark Brnovich, or Pima County Superior Court Judge Kellie Johnson, a Ducey appointee. On Friday, Johnson upheld Brnovich's request to [reinstate a draconian abortion ban](~/AASU4wA~/RgRlFVzWP0RSaHR0cHM6Ly93d3cuc2Fsb24uY29tLzIwMjIvMDkvMjQvYXJpem9uYS1hcHByb3Zlcy1uZWFyLXRvdGFsLWFib3J0aW9uLWJhbl9wYXJ0bmVyL1cDc3BjQgpjItnXMmMWvAJLUht0cmlzdHJhbWJhbGR3aW44NUBnbWFpbC5jb21YBAAAACg~) that dates back to 1864. That was 48 years before Arizona became a state (and women got the right to vote there) and 56 years before women's suffrage was nationalized in the 19th Amendment. When feminists and abortion-rights advocates say that Republicans intend to turn the clock back to the 19th century, they really aren't exaggerating. This intention has never been far below the surface. While Republicans often like to fashion themselves as feminists in the style of the suffragists — mostly in order reject the 20th-century feminism that fought for reproductive rights — their contempt for the goals of even the first wave of feminism has been peeking out more and more often.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
